The Complex Science of Insulin Signaling and Resistance
Insulin is a hormone produced by beta cells in the pancreas, vital for regulating carbohydrates and fat metabolism. When glucose enters the blood, insulin binds to receptors on cellular membranes, initiating a cascade of intracellular signals that recruit glucose transporter proteins (GLUT4) to the cell surface. This allows glucose to enter cells, lowering blood sugar. However, chronic overconsumption of carbohydrates causes constant, high insulin release. Over time, receptors become desensitized to insulin, a condition known as insulin resistance. The pancreas compensates by producing even more insulin to force glucose into cells. This state of hyperinsulinemia prevents lipolysis (fat breakdown) and encourages lipogenesis (fat storage), particularly visceral fat accumulation around organs, leading to cardiovascular risk, metabolic syndrome, and fatigue.
The Physical Action of Soluble Fiber and Gastric Gel Barriers
Soluble fiber matrices, such as the Biosphere fiber system, operate on physical and chemical principles in the gut. Upon hydration in the stomach, the fiber particles swell and form a thick, viscous gel. This gel slows down gastric emptying, delaying the transit of food into the duodenum. In the small intestine, the viscous gel acts as a physical barrier, trapping sugars and starch molecules. This slows down their exposure to digestive enzymes (like amylase) and delays their absorption across the intestinal microvilli. Consequently, glucose enters the bloodstream gradually over several hours, rather than in a sudden spike. This flat glucose curve prevents the subsequent crash in blood sugar, eliminating reactive hypoglycemia, reducing insulin demand, and helping maintain stable, long-lasting energy.
The Metabolic Pathway of Autophagy and Ketosis
During a 16-hour fast, the body transitions from an anabolic state (storing energy) to a catabolic state (mobilizing energy). As liver glycogen stores are depleted, insulin levels drop, and glucagon levels rise. This shift activates hormone-sensitive lipase, which breaks down triglycerides in adipose tissue into free fatty acids. These fatty acids are transported to the liver, where they undergo beta-oxidation to produce ketone bodies (acetoacetate and beta-hydroxybutyrate). Ketones cross the blood-brain barrier, providing an alternative fuel source that is more energy-efficient than glucose and produces fewer reactive oxygen species. Fasting also triggers autophagy, where cells degrade damaged mitochondria, misfolded proteins, and viral components. This cellular recycling promotes longevity, reduces inflammation, and restores metabolic health.

Strategies for Achieving Metabolic Resilience and Flexibility
Metabolic flexibility is the body's capacity to adapt fuel oxidation to fuel availability, easily switching between burning carbohydrates and fats. In an unhealthy metabolic state, the body is locked into burning glucose, leading to frequent hunger and fatigue. To rebuild this flexibility, one must combine consistent fasting windows with targeted fiber supplementation. Taking a fiber matrix before meals slows digestion and insulin release, while morning fasting extends the fat-burning state. Regular physical activity, adequate sleep, and reducing refined sugar intake complement this protocol. Over weeks and months, cellular pathways adapt, insulin sensitivity improves, and energy levels stabilize, providing lasting resilience against modern chronic metabolic conditions.
